Ventory funding news - Belgium-based Ventory Secures €1.75 Million in Seed Funding

Ventory, the Belgium-based company developing a field and remote inventory management software since 2021, raises €1.75M seed funding round. Its SaaS solution is trusted by some of the world’s largest enterprises aiming to digitize and reach field services excellence.

SUMMARY

  • Ventory, the Belgium-based company developing a field and remote inventory management software since 2021, raises €1.75M seed funding round.
  • Ventory, Belgian company founded in 2021, enables field services companies to gain complete control and visibility over their field inventory to the very end - including forward stock locations and engineers’ vans.

It’s Seed round was co-led by Ghent-based Finindus (backed by ArcelorMittal) and Munich-based Matterwave Ventures. The consulting firm delaware, recognizing it's value as an extension to ERPs like SAP also participated through Ventures by delaware (the Corporate Venture arm of delaware).

The €1.75M raised will accelerate product development, enable team expansion, and expand Ventory’s market presence. This investment underscores confidence in it’s mission to provide real-time visibility and control over field inventory, optimizing global operational efficiency. It’s rise continues, following its win at the 6th European Supply Chain Startup Contest in 2023.

Vishal Punamiya, Founder and CEO of Ventory said, "Drawing from +12 years of firsthand experience with field operations at DHL and Panalpina, I am thrilled to receive recognition today for the Ventory platform. The challenges I faced during my tenure have profoundly shaped our approach, leading to a solution that truly supports and enhances the work of field engineers and operators. This acknowledgment from leading investors in smart industrial technologies not only validates our efforts but also underscores their confidence in Ventory's potential to scale and make a meaningful impact in the industry. I am both honored and grateful for this support"

Roel Callebaut, Senior Investment Manager at Finindus said, “Ventory is solving the lack of inventory visibility in forward stocking locations, which is essential in fulfilling SLA requirements in many industries, We were impressed by how precisely they understand the challenges their customers are facing, and how they’ve been able to find a user-friendly solution to address a complex problem.”

Benedikt Kronberger, Partner at Matterwave ventures adds “Ventory’s experienced team has developed a software platform, that enables its customers to gain full visibility of inventory at edge locations, even including moving inventory, such as in vans or consignment stock. Unlike existing solutions, the platform is designed to be easy to use, allowing even untrained users to effectively manage inventory, which will certainly be a key driver for user adoption."

About Ventory

Ventory, Belgian company founded in 2021, enables field services companies to gain complete control and visibility over their field inventory to the very end - including forward stock locations and engineers’ vans. Whether standalone or seamlessly connected to existing WMS or ERP systems such as SAP, it’s SaaS simplifies inventory management and empowers professionals in the field to take accurate, data-driven decisions.
